Question:
Searched the outside casing of our Fulton trailer jack, not able to find a part number to insure I get the correct jack. We have a 21foot Centurion ski boat on a double axle trailer made in Cailf. How can I find a part number so I buy the correct bolt thru replacement jack ??? The lift tube extending out of the jack is currently bent.
asked by: Greg
Helpful Expert Reply:
Your 21' Centurion Ski Boat weighs around 3,000 lbs. I always like to use the rule of half. Clearly the jack does not need to lift the entire boats weight but you want one that is not going to have to overwork to lift the tongue either.
In that case the Fulton Bolt-Thru Swivel Marine Jack part # F1411300301 is going to be your perfect solution. With it's 1,500 lb. lift capacity it is going to get the job done really well and will last for years! The larger wheel will also make moving it around a whole lot easier.
